Stone wall hardscaping services involve the construction and installation of durable, aesthetically pleasing walls made from natural stone, brick, or other hard materials. These structures serve both functional and decorative purposes, such as creating property boundaries, defining garden spaces, or adding visual interest to landscapes. Skilled contractors often work with a variety of stone types and design styles to ensure the walls complement the existing property features and meet specific needs. Proper construction techniques are essential to ensure the stability and longevity of these walls, especially in areas prone to shifting or erosion.

One of the primary benefits of stone wall hardscaping is its ability to address common landscape problems. For properties experiencing soil erosion, retaining walls built from stone can provide essential support and prevent land degradation. Additionally, stone walls can serve as barriers against wind and water, helping to protect gardens, lawns, and structures from damage. They also help manage uneven terrain, creating level spaces for outdoor activities or planting beds. By providing structural support and visual separation, stone walls can enhance both the functionality and appearance of a property.

The overview below groups typical Stone Wall Hardsc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Littleton, NH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Stone Wall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ing stone walls ranges from $20 to $80 per linear foot, depending on the type of stone and wall height. For example, a 50-foot wall could cost between $1,000 and $4,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on project scope.

Material Expenses - The price of stones varies widely, with natural stones costing between $10 and $50 per square foot. The choice of material impacts overall costs, with options like fieldstone or limestone influencing the final price. Contact local service providers for material recommendations and pricing.

Labor Costs - Labor charges for stone wall construction typically range from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on complexity and site conditions. A standard project might require 10 to 40 hours of work, affecting total labor expenses. Local contractors can give specific labor estimates for individual projects.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include foundation preparation, permits, or decorative capstones, which can add several hundred dollars to the project. These expenses vary based on project requirements and local regulations. Consulting local pros can help identify potential additional cost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for stone wall hardscaping services, it is important to consider their experience in designing and constructing durable, aesthetically pleasing walls. Homeowners should inquire about the length of time a contractor has been working in the local area and their familiarity with regional materials and landscape styles. A contractor with a solid track record can often provide a portfolio of completed projects, demonstrating their expertise and versatility in handling different types of stone walls and site conditions.

Clear communication and well-defined expectations are essential when working with a hardscaping contractor. Homeowners should seek providers who are transparent about their process, materials, and potential challenges, ensuring that all project details are discussed upfront. Reputable local pros typically offer detailed proposals and are responsive to questions, helping to foster a collaborative and informed working relationship throughout the project.

Reputation and references play a crucial role in evaluating stone wall contractors. Pros with established credibility in the community often have references or reviews from previous clients that highlight their professionalism, quality of work, and reliability. It is advisable to contact these references to gain insights into their experiences and to verify the contractor’s ability to meet project expectations.
